Hey,
I think in python, you use Lambda Expressions. Here is how I would do it in python3: import math f = lambda x: math.cos(x) + x d_f = lambda x: (f(x + 1e-8) - f(x)) * 1e8

Hi,
We, Smalltalkers, use bloc of code as easily as we breathe air.
I am writing an article on Smalltalk programming for a French mathematics teachers magazine.
To illustrate the simplicity of Smalltalk, I would like to compare how the bloc of code 'f' and 'df' below will be implemented in Javascript and Python:
f := [ :x | x cos + x ]. df := [ :x | (f value: x + 1e-8) - (f value: x) * 1e8].
Here f is a way to implement a function and df its derivate.
Do some of you knows how it will be written in Javascript and Python with their own ad-hoc anonymous function?
